Conclusion Meanings:

'Exonerated': or 'Within NYPD Guidelines' - The conduct occurred but did not violate the NYPD's own rules, which often give officers significant discretion.
'Unfounded': Evidence suggests that the event or alleged conduct did not occur.
'Unsubstantiated': or 'Unable to Determine' - The alleged conduct was investigated but could not determine both that the conduct occurred and that it broke the rules.

Summary

At 7:46 on October 30, 2019, [redacted] was at a shelter at [redacted] with her [redacted] son and [redacted] daughter. She had a dispute with a Department of Homeless Services (DHS) worker, who told [redacted] that she was not assigned to this shelter and was supposed to be at a shelter in the Bronx. The worker called the police when [redacted] refused leave. The responding officers were Police Officer Robert Desena and Police Officer Brianna Orloff of the 60th Precinct, and they told [redacted] she needed to leave the shelter. [redacted] refused to leave, so PO Desena pushed her out of the lobby into the foyer of the building, and then pulled her outside the side entrance (Allegation A – Force, physical force, [redacted]).
Once outside the shelter, [redacted] called 911 to file an IAB complaint. She stayed outside the side entrance to the shelter, and PO Desena and PO Orloff remained with her to ensure she did not re-enter. PO Desena threatened to arrest [redacted] if she re-entered the building (Allegation B – Abuse of Authority, threat of arrest, [redacted]). PO Desena also informed [redacted] that if she were arrested, her children would have to be taken by ACS (Allegation C- Abuse of Authority, threat to notify ACS, [redacted]). PO Desena told [redacted]s children that if their mother re-entered the premises, he would have to arrest her (Allegation D- Abuse of Authority, threat of arrest, [redacted]). PO Desena then called his supervisor, Lieutenant Michael Desposito of the 60th Precinct and, while explaining the situation to him, referred to [redacted] as "crazy" and "going nuts" while she was standing within earshot (Allegation E- Offensive Language other, [redacted]). PO Desena then allegedly said he was going to call an ambulance to get [redacted] a psychological evaluation. (Allegation F- Abuse of Authority, threat re: removal to hospital, [redacted]).
